James Fussell, Governor

James FussellI am privileged to be appointed as Public Governor for the Trust as a representative from the University of Derby. I have worked in higher education for many years and have also worked in the private sector, in legal, governance and other roles.

My professional career has centred on legal, governance and assurance leadership, and I bring that perspective with me into this role. Through my work, I have seen first-hand how strong governance, clear values, and good decision-making shape organisational success. I hope to use this experience to contribute constructively and thoughtfully to the future of the NHS.

Like everyone, I have my own experiences of the NHS as a patient and family member, and I recognise the importance of bringing that perspective. But I also want to champion the perspectives of those who will form the NHS workforce of the future — the students at our University and the staff who collaborate closely with Trust colleagues in delivering education, training and research.

I recognise both the immense value of the NHS and the significant pressures it faces. It remains one of the most trusted and beloved institutions in public life, even while undergoing profound challenge and transformation. I hope to play a meaningful part in helping it evolve in a positive direction — grounded in good governance, strong relationships and a genuine commitment to inclusion.
